Ошибка с кодом 0x000000d1

Один из распространенных вариантов «синих экранов смерти» (BSoD) — ошибка 0x000000d1, встречающаяся у пользователей Windows 10, 8, Windows 7 и XP. В Windows 10 и 8 синий экран выглядит чуть иначе — код ошибки отсутствует, лишь сообщение DRIVER_IRQL_NOT_LESS_OR_EQUAL и информация о файле, вызвавшем её. Сама по себе ошибка говорит о том, что какой-либо драйвер системы обратился к несуществующей странице памяти, что и вызвало сбой.

В инструкции ниже — способы исправить синий экран STOP 0x000000D1, выявить проблемный драйвер или другие причины, вызывающие появление ошибки и вернуть Windows к нормальной работе. В первой части речь будет идти применительно к Windows 10 — 7, во второй — специфичные решения для XP (но для XP актуальны и способы из первой части статьи). В последнем разделе перечислены дополнительные, иногда встречающиеся причины появления этой ошибки в обеих операционных системах.

Как исправить синий экран 0x000000D1 DRIVER_IRQL_NOT_LESS_OR_EQUAL в Windows 10, 8 и Windows 7

Ошибка с кодом 0x000000d1

Сначала о самых простых и самых распространенных вариантах ошибки 0x000000D1 DRIVER_IRQL_NOT_LESS_OR_EQUAL в Windows 10, 8 и 7, не требующих анализа дампа памяти и иных расследований для определения причины.

Если при появлении ошибки на синем экране вы видите имя какого-либо файла с расширением .sys — именно этот файл драйвера и вызвал ошибку. Причем чаще всего это бывают следующие драйвера:

Отдельно по ошибке STOP 0x000000D1 ndis.sys — в некоторых случаях для установки нового драйвера сетевой карты при постоянно появляющемся синем экране смерти, следует зайти в безопасный режим (без поддержки сети) и проделать следующее:

Если ничто из этого списка не подходит под вашу ситуацию, но имя файла, вызвавшего ошибку, отображается на синем экране в информации об ошибке, попробуйте найти в Интернете, к драйверу какого устройства относится этот файл и также попробуйте либо установить официальный вариант этого драйвера, либо, если есть такая возможность — откатить его в диспетчере устройств (если ранее ошибка не возникала).

Если же имя файла не отображается, можно использовать бесплатную программу BlueScreenView для анализа дампа памяти (в ней будут отображаться имена файлов, вызвавших сбой) при условии, что у вас включено сохранение дампов памяти (обычно включено по умолчанию, если отключено, см. Как включить автоматическое создание дампов памяти при сбоях Windows).

Ошибка с кодом 0x000000d1

Чтобы включить сохранение дампов памяти при, зайдите в «Панель управления» — «Система» — «Дополнительные параметры системы». На вкладке «Дополнительно» в разделе «Загрузка и восстановление» нажмите «Параметры» и включите запись событий при отказе системы.

Ошибка с кодом 0x000000d1

Дополнительно: для Windows 7 SP1 и ошибки, вызванной файлами tcpip.sys, netio.sys, fwpkclnt.sys есть официальное исправление, доступное здесь: https://support.microsoft.com/ru-ru/kb/2851149 (нажать «Пакет исправлений доступен для скачивания»).

Ошибка 0x000000D1 в Windows XP

Прежде всего, если в Windows XP указанный синий экран смерти возникает у вас при подключении к Интернету или других действиях с сетью, рекомендую установить официальное исправление с сайта Microsoft, возможно поможет уже оно: https://support.microsoft.com/ru-ru/kb/916595 (предназначено для ошибок, вызванных http.sys, но иногда помогает и в других ситуациях). Обновление: почему-то загрузка на указанной странице больше не работает, есть только описание ошибки.

Отдельно можно выделить ошибки kbdclass.sys и usbohci.sys в Windows XP — они могут относиться к ПО и драйверам клавиатуры и мыши от производителя. В остальном, способы исправить ошибку те же, что и в предыдущей части.

Читайте также:  Был вызван код ошибки Insite 27206

Дополнительная информация

Ошибка с кодом 0x000000d1

Причинами ошибки DRIVER_IRQL_NOT_LESS_OR_EQUAL в некоторых случаях также могут быть следующие вещи:

Ну и еще два теоретически возможных варианта причины — отключенный файл подкачки Windows или проблемы с оперативной памятью компьютера или ноутбука. Также, если проблема появилась после установки какого-либо ПО, проверьте, возможно на вашем компьютере есть точки восстановления Windows, которые позволят быстро исправить проблему.

Если при работе вы столкнулись с ошибкой (синим экраном) DRIVER_IRQL_NOT_LESS_OR_EQUAL, кодом 0x000000d1 и указанием сбойного модуля ndis.sys, вероятнее всего проблема в работе сети. NDIS — это Network Driver Interface Specification, в свою очередь ndis.sys — драйвер интерфейса для работы операционной системы в сети.

В этой инструкции — способы исправить ошибку 0x000000d1 ndis.sys в Windows 10, 8.1 или Windows 7 и устранить появление синего экрана DRIVER_IRQL_NOT_LESS_OR_EQUAL ndis.sys. Про эту же ошибку с другими файлами драйверов в отдельной инструкции: Как исправить ошибку DRIVER_IRQL_NOT_LESS_OR_EQUAL 0x000000d1.

Исправление ошибки ndis. sys 0x000000d1

Ошибка с кодом 0x000000d1

Наиболее частыми причинами синего экрана (BSoD) DRIVER_IRQL_NOT_LESS_OR_EQUAL ndis.sys являются неправильная работа драйверов сетевой карты или влияние стороннего ПО на их работу, в частности, это может быть сторонний антивирус. В списке ниже — способы исправления проблемы от более простых к более сложным:

Обычно, один из приведенных методов позволяет избавиться от синего экрана, вызываемого ndis.sys, но не всегда.

В случае, если вышеописанные способы не помогли, попробуйте использовать дополнительные подходы, в редких случаях они помогают.

Дополнительные методы исправления ошибки

Ну и, наконец, последний способ, если ничто не помогает решить проблему, а она не является аппаратной и не вызвана проблемами с электропитанием, статическим электричеством или поврежденными кабелями, остается переустановка или сброс Windows.

Пользователи компьютеров и ноутбуков с Windows 11/10/7 могут столкнуться с резким вылетом и ошибкой x000000D1 BSOD на синем экране.

Код остановки 0x000000D1 BSOD обычно сопровождается комментарием и указанием на файл драйвера, nvlddmkm.sys, atikmdag.sys, ndis.sys и т.д.

Причиной ошибки 0x000000D1 на синем экране в Windows 11/10/7 является проблемы с драйверами, сторонним антивирусом, системной службой, повреждением внутренних системных файлов и реестра.

Ошибка 0x000000D1 в Windows 11/10

Перейдите ниже по ссылке для полного руководства по исправлению BSOD с кодом ошибки 0x000000D1, который указывает хоть на один файл из предоставленного списка.

📌 Ошибка BSOD 0x000000D1 не является циклический и пользователь может попасть на рабочий стол. Если вдруг ошибка входит в цикл и появляется каждый раз при включении ПК, то загрузитесь в безопасном режиме Windows.

Исправить поврежденные системные файлы

Запустите командную строку от имени администратора и введите ниже команды по порядку:

Ошибка с кодом 0x000000d1

Обновите драйверы

Устаревшие или несовместимые драйверы устройств могут быть причиной ошибки 0x000000D1 на синем экране в Windows 11/10.

📌 Если нет никаких обновлений и список пусть, это означает, что для вашего ПК нет обновлений устройств.

Ошибка с кодом 0x000000d1

Ошибка с кодом 0x000000d1

Сканирование на вирусы

Вредоносное ПО может быть причиной синего экрана с кодом ошибки 0x000000D1 в Windows 11/10 и 7. Воспользуйтесь как HitmanPro или Dr Web CureIt, чтобы выявить угрозы на ПК.

Ошибка с кодом 0x000000d1

Удалите сторонний антивирус

Если у вас установлен сторонний антивирус, то он может блокировать файлы драйверов и вызывать синий экран в Windows 11/10/7 с кодом ошибки 0x000000D1. Виновником был замечен McAfee антивирус. Если установлен сторонний антивирусный продукт, то удалите его полностью при помощи специальных утилит от самих разработчиков.

Читайте также:  Внутренний документ, связанный с внешним идентификатором, не найден из-за кода ошибки 1010

Тест памяти ОЗУ

Сделайте диагностику памяти, если ошибка 0x000000D1 возникает при больших нагрузках как в играх с вылетом на синий экран.

Ошибка с кодом 0x000000d1

Устранение неполадок устройств

Нажмите Win+R и введите msdt.exe -id DeviceDiagnostic, чтобы выявить проблемы с устройствами и автоматически исправить их.

Ошибка с кодом 0x000000d1

Откатите систему Windows

Ошибка с кодом 0x000000d1

Ошибка 0x000000D1 является очередным синим экраном смерти, тем самым явлением, которое так сильно пугает всех пользователей операционных систем Windows, даже самых опытных из них.

По своей природе, исправление большинства синих экранов смерти занимает просто невероятное количество времени и ваших нервных клеток. Однако, если вы стали “везунчиком” и увидели на экране 0x000000D1, то у нас для вас хорошая новость — этот синий экран смерти является простым случаем и справиться с ним можно довольно быстро.

Для начала нужно разобраться в причине появления данного синего экрана. Так уж свезло, что у простого синего экрана смерти простая причина появления — некорректно работающие драйвера.

Возможно, что вы совсем недавно устанавливали новые драйвера для какой-то аппаратной составляющей вашей конфигурации. Эти драйвера могли быть несовместимы с вашей системой, повреждены изначально или они стали таковыми во время скачивания с определенного ресурса.

В общем, проблема заключается в неисправных драйверах, из-за которых в системе происходит конфликт. Вследствие этого конфликта система сбоит и на экране вы наблюдаете синий экран смерти с кодом ошибки 0x000000D1.

Отлично, теперь, когда мы ознакомились с причиной возникновения такой проблемы, как ошибка 0x000000D1, давайте рассмотрим методы того, как от нее избавиться.

Методы исправления ошибки 0x000000D1

Ошибка с кодом 0x000000d1

Узнав о том, что причиной синего экрана смерти является сбоящий драйвер, вы, наверняка, подумали “А как мне понять, какой именно драйвер является причиной синего экрана смерти?”

Ответ на ваш вопрос можно найти на самом синем экране смерти. На нем, в большинстве случаев, указывается определенный драйвер, из-за которого возник конфликт в системе и краш в ней.

Вот список некоторых драйверов, чтобы вы представили с чем будете иметь дело:

Заметка: вся суть заключается в начальных буквах имени обозначенных драйверов, т.е. nv=Nvidia и тому подобные аналогии. Просто вбейте в поисковик не знакомое вам название и вы определенно найдете нужную информацию о драйвере.

Теперь давайте разберем то, что поможет вам избавиться от синего экрана смерти с кодом ошибки 0x000000D1.

Метод №1 Обновление драйверов

В первую очередь, пожалуй, нужно попытаться попросту обновить драйвера, т.е. заменить несовместимые с системой. Что и как обновить — это уже зависит от того, с какими именно драйверами у вас возникла проблема.

Можете попробовать обновить драйвера через Диспетчер устройств. Для этого сделайте следующее:

Метод №2 Откат драйверов до предыдущей версии

Если обновление не помогло, пора начинать заниматься откатом драйверов до предыдущей версии, с которой нормально работала операционная система. Для отката драйверов вам придется снова пройти в Диспетчер устройств:

Метод №3 Специальный пакет исправлений

Если вы являетесь владельцем операционной системы Windows 7 или Windows RT, то можете попробовать установить один небольшой пакет исправления от самих разработчиков.

Метод №4 Восстановление системы

Если ничего из вышеперечисленного вам не помогло, а такое маловероятно, но все же не невозможно, вы можете попробовать провести восстановление системы. Данный шаг всегда является самым действенным и он позволит обратить все изменения, которые были произведены в ближайшее время в операционной системы.

Читайте также:  Контроллер sata ahci не может запуститься с кодом ошибки аппаратного вывода 10

Для запуска процесса восстановления системы сделайте следующее:

После проведения Восстановления системы, синий экран смерти и ошибка 0x000000D1 должны будут наверняка исчезнуть, так как ранее принесенные изменения в систему будут отменены. Но если даже Восстановление системы не помогло, по каким-то причинам, то единственным вариантом в этом случае остается полная переустановка операционной системы.

Причины синего экрана 0x0000001D в Windows 10, 7 напоминают и любой другой BSOD – проблемы операционной системы и ее файлов, неисправность драйверов, повреждение жесткого диска, некорректно установленные обновления. Однако есть и более специфические источники неисправности в виде недостатка полномочий для доступа к диску, конфликт временных файлов Windows, не характерные для большинства фатальных ошибок системы. Тем и лучше, ведь понимание имеет вид

0x0000001D, ERROR_WRITE_FAULT, The system cannot write to the specified device.

Как исправить BSOD?

Первым делом рекомендуем выполнить стандартную для разных BSOD процедуру сканирования системных файлов и состояния диска. Чтобы проанализировать состояние Windows 10, нужно использовать sfc /scannow (команда вставляется в командную строку с привилегиями администратора). Для проверки диска достаточно вставить chkdsk /r, если ошибки будут найдены, система попытается их исправить. Возможно, ей это не удастся, поэтому нужно посмотреть результат каждой процедуры.

Совет! Более полная проверка диска может быть запущена командой chkdsk C: /f /r /x, порой она помогает лучше.

1) Использовать средство устранения неполадок оборудования

Данный инструмент неудобно запускать вручную, так как требуется идентификатор, а его выдает служба поддержки. Зато средство достаточно легко использовать через командную строку или PowerShell.

Что нужно сделать:

Ошибка с кодом 0x000000d1

2) Очистить папку Temp

Различные проблемные файлы в папке Temp часто становятся причиной ошибок, но обычно они не приводят к столь серьезным проблемам, как BSOD. Конкретно этот код 0x0000001D может появляться по причине повреждения файлов здесь.

Вот, как это можно исправить:

3) Выдать права на использование диска

Очень часто ошибка 0x0000001D становится следствием недостатка полномочий для записи данных на диск. Возможно, вы создали нового пользователя без этих привилегий, вручную выполняли какие-то настройки или в системе завелся вирус.

Ошибка с кодом 0x000000d1

4) Форматировать диск

Последний, своего рода запасной способ – форматирование. К нему приходится прибегать в случае, если все остальное не работает. Данная процедура приведет к потере всех файлов, поэтому нужно хорошо осознавать последствия и заранее побеспокоиться о резервной копии. На время можно переместить файлы с одного логического диска на другой.

Как это сделать:

Ошибка с кодом 0x000000d1

Мы об этом не писали, но сделать все равно нужно – установить свежие обновления и проверить драйвера. Дело в том, что иногда BSOD 0x0000001D появляется при определенных странных причинах. Например, у одного пользователя возникает синий экран после подключения кабеля интернета, но по Wi-Fi работает нормально. Логично, что проблема может заключаться в драйверах сетевой карты. Если вам удалось отследить первопричину проблемы, стоит продолжить логическую цепочку в этом направлении. Все более универсальные решения изложены выше, и они работают у большинства пользователей.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*